Accessories for the classy gent

October 31,2022
Share:

By Josephine Agbonkhese 


Accessories are like vitamins to fashion. In fact, the perfect accessory can make the difference between looking empty and looking classy. 


Accessories or add-ons are so transforming that they could be your surest escape route when also bored with monotonous looks; simply adding the right fashion accessories can instantly transform and elevate your style. 


Find here four accessories you can wear, either separately or all at once, for casual, formal or semi-formal occasions.

A scarf
A scarf gives your look a complete makeover. Luckily, scarves can be worn all seasons and to all occasions as they not only enhance style but also provide warmth
Opt for the perfect material as per the weather, and explore various draping styles.

Many different bracelets 
This accessory can be magical when wearing a shirt whose sleeves arent covering your entire wrists.
The trick is to take five-six different bracelets on one hand, so long as they are small enough in size. 

Trendy sunglasses
Sunglasses give you that required X-factor. They not only shield your eyes but also make you more influential so that people tend to also remember your face more after an encounter. 

Neck bead
Every classy gent should have, in his collection, classy neck beads; especially when wearing casual outfits that require the first two buttons to be unfastened or when wearing a turtleneck t-shirt.
This bead gives you a sharp look while also drawing attention to itself.
